Transaction cdf23794fdf4c4a5cb0283b1ead93eda42592d61751c4f4ece9f8b4330af88e6
1 Input
2 Outputs
- cdf23794fdf4c4a5cb0283b1ead93eda42592d61751c4f4ece9f8b4330af88e6:0
- cdf23794fdf4c4a5cb0283b1ead93eda42592d61751c4f4ece9f8b4330af88e6:1
value 1576509
address 16mB7sPh8hihFnP3pG3SYtu27fTj8WDMua
value 3573577
address 17PiMkBD51aD9bK5ucPvc7wbDEK8e2cnEr